Top Reasons to Study in UK
Studying abroad is a significant decision for any student, requiring careful consideration of various factors before selecting a destination and academic institution. Here are some compelling reasons why choosing the UK for your studies might be a wise decision:
- Academic Excellence: According to the QS World University Rankings 2023, four UK universities rank in the top 10 globally, including prestigious institutions like the University of Cambridge, the University of Oxford, Imperial College London, and University College London. Additionally, the University of Oxford holds the top position in the Times World University Rankings 2023, reflecting the high academic standards and research output of UK universities.
- Research Opportunities: The recent Research Excellence Framework 2021 evaluated research across 157 UK universities, with a significant portion deemed world-leading or internationally excellent. This underscores the UK’s reputation for producing groundbreaking research, making it an attractive destination for students interested in pursuing research careers.
- International Student-Friendly Environment: In the academic year 2020-21, over 605,000 international students, including both EU and non-EU nationals, were enrolled in UK higher education institutions. With approximately 55,000 new enrollments from India alone, the UK continues to attract a growing number of international students, reflecting its popularity as a study abroad destination.
- Scholarships Opportunities: UK universities offer a range of scholarships to international students, such as the International Scholarships Award, Commonwealth Scholarship and Fellowship, Chevening Scholarships, GREAT Scholarships, and Charles Wallace India Trust Scholarships, among others. These scholarships help alleviate financial burdens and make studying in the UK more accessible.
- Cultural Exploration and Travel: The UK boasts a rich tapestry of historical landmarks, music events, diverse cuisines, and cultural festivals, providing students with ample opportunities for leisure and exploration. Studying at a UK university allows students to immerse themselves in the country’s vibrant heritage and traditions, adding to the overall educational experience.
UK Universities Accepting TOEFL Scores| List of Top 2024
According to the official ETS website, all universities in the UK, including the esteemed Russell Group universities, accept the TOEFL iBT test for admission. As of 2024; you need to secure 70 to 90 points points in TOEFL to get admission to the universities in the UK. There are so many popular colleges that need 92 + points to give you admission.
